Here are the main points for a speech about the components of a medieval coat of armor. I. The head was protected by a helmet. I
docker41 [41]

Answer:

Spatial order.

Explanation:

A speech is said to be organized in a spatial order when the main ideas or points for a speech follow a directional pattern or towards space.

This simply means that a spatial order involves organizing the main points in a directional pattern, according to their geographical relationships or towards space, such as from top to bottom, left to the right

For instance, the main points for a speech about the components of a medieval coat of armor is arranged in a spatial order as;

I. The head was protected by a helmet.

II. The torso was protected by shoulder pieces, palates, a breastplate, a skirt of tasses, and a tuille.

III. The arms and hands were protected by brassards, elbow pieces, and gauntlets.

IV. The legs and feet were protected by cuisses, knee pieces, jambeaux, and sollerets.  

A spatial order involves using a set of transitive words or phrases such as, above, behind, in front, beneath, near, to the right or left of, alongside, farther along etc. It is also used to give a description of the logical progression of something in relation to another.
